iPhone 3G Lineup Forms in Japan

A lineup of approximately 20 people waiting for the iPhone has formed in Japan at the Harajuku Softbank store, according to a MacWorld report.
It will be a 73 hour wait for Hiroyuki Sano a 24 year old student lining up for the iPhone. When the iPhone was announced I watched Steve Jobs keynote and thought it looked like a great product and Ive wanted one ever since, he says.
The iPhone will officially go on sale in Tokyo at 7 a.m. on Friday morning.
